Product details
The Microflex 93-260 disposable gloves from Ansell offer high protection and excellent tactile sensitivity. These gloves are made from a special three-layer construction of nitrile and neoprene, which is both chemical-resistant and comfortable. They are ideal for various applications in the industry, including aerospace, automotive, chemicals, electronics, and metalworking. The textured fingertips provide a secure grip, while the thin-walled design promotes finger mobility. These gloves are powder-free and feature a rolled cuff for easier handling. They meet the requirements of the EN 388 and EN 374 standards, highlighting their suitability for use in demanding environments.
- Outstanding protection against chemicals, including acids and solvents
- Thin-walled construction for increased tactile sensitivity
- Anatomical fit for optimal wearing comfort
- Textured fingertips for better grip
- Silicone-free and suitable for use in sensitive areas.
